Kas di Kurason, a vacation rental home, focuses on those with special needs.

Have you ever wanted to go on vacation, but were in the middle of physical therapy, needed assistance from a nurse due to physical or mental challenges, or had a family member that needed assistance? Look no further than Kas di Kurason on Bonaire. Kas di Kurason (Papiamentu for House of Hearts) has been designed as a fully accessible, intimate vacation rental with a nurse on staff for any of your needs.

The rental home comes with a variety of accessible features.

Kas di Kurason was designed specifically to accommodate people with physical and mental challenges. The vacation rental home is set in a tranquil garden, perfect for a relaxing vacation.

As you approach the house, you first notice that there are no steps and that the entryway into the rental home is wider than usual. This provides people using wheelchairs or walkers easy access. In fact, all the doors inside are also oversized. The bathroom also offers accessible features such as a higher toilet with arms, a shower chair, and handles for assistance.

Kas di Kurason is a two-bedroom, one-bathroom home. The bedrooms are accessible for wheelchairs and walkers. You can choose which room is easiest to access from your wheelchair or walker into the bed. This feature was designed in case a guest is stronger on one side of the body than the other.

Who can rent the apartment?

Anyone needing a helping hand when vacationing on Bonaire, whether it is physical or mental challenges, can make a reservation. Since it is a two-bedroom rental, it sleeps up to four people.

Ingrid, your nurse, will make sure you have everything you need. With her nursing credentials, Ingrid can handle various physical and mental challenges in adults and children. Ingrid can assist in numerous ways, such as physical therapy, shopping, arranging a private chef, and even being your tour guide and nurse as you view the highlights of Bonaire. She can even assist with aqua therapy in the Caribbean Sea using beach wheelchairs if needed.

Of course, you can also choose to bring your own caretaker and have peace of mind that your accommodation is fully accessible.

How can I make a reservation?

Kas di Kurason has a booking process to ensure the guests and your nurse, Ingrid, are a good fit. First, you make a reservation on the website. Soon after, you will receive a detailed questionnaire so Ingrid knows what assistance is required. After that, a video call will be scheduled to discuss things further. Communication is essential for all involved so that preparations can be made and everyone feels comfortable knowing they are in good hands when arriving on Bonaire.
